Any player who can make a jump shot from any location on the basketball court is of course going to be a very valued member of the team. Just think of what a John Paxson or Steve Kerr did for Michael Jordan. A spot up shooter will always have a place on any team on which he or she plays. Of course it helps if you can also create your own shot by utilizing a dribble drive. But the basic fundamentals on offense comes down to how well you can shoot the basketball.
In order to become a better shooter, you must first learn the proper shooting mechanics. After that, it's a matter of repetition. Practice shooting 1000 jump shots a day, and I guarantee your friends will be amazed at your accuracy the next time you play with them. Once you have a solid jump shot, then you can think about expanding your game to include a good dribble drive and a post game.
Ideally, you want to learn how to be a triple threat on offense. Some coaches describe the triple threat concept by saying the offensive player has the choice of driving, passing, or shooting. I tend to think of the triple threat as being able to drive to the right, drive to the left, or take a jumper. In order to be a true triple threat in this sense, you must learn how to drive to your off hand (normally the left hand for most players).
If you do not have a good jump shot, the defender won't respect you, and will back away so you can't drive by him. Conversely, if you can't drive past anyone, the defender won't be afraid of you blowing by him, and he'll be up in your face so you can't shoot.
Now, defense on the other hand is a great deal dependent on your aggressiveness and desire. You want to be like a madman, shutting down your opponent's offense by taking away his jump shot yet not letting him drive by you. Of course you want to be controlled, you don't want to be a foul monster and foul out of every game, but the point is you need to have a lot of energy and intensity.
As a defender, make sure you do not look at your opponent's eyes. A good player will throw all kinds of fakes at you, eye fakes, head fakes, shoulder fakes, ball fakes, and foot fakes. A good offensive player will not look where he's passing the ball, so don't get fooled by those Magic Johnson fake out passes. Where you really want to always be looking is at your opponent's center of gravity -- at the center of his waist. Imagine he's wearing a belt -- where his belt buckle goes, the player goes. Keeping your eyes on your opponent's center of gravity will alone increase your defensive capability by a big margin.
A lot of defense is also psychological. Dennis Rodman was a master of this. You want to get inside your opponent's head. Keep your hand in his face at all times, annoy him and distract him like a fly or mosquito. Always shadow him wherever he goes (this is assuming you're playing man-to-man of course). The idea is to frustrate your opponent and to make him sick and tired of you. If you're defending in the post, bang him around. Don't let him get position without paying a heavy price.

The Many Styles Of Belt Vacuums
The belts for vacuum cleaners can come in many styles and hundreds of different sizes. Normally, vacuums use a belt to drive an agitation device, which is also known as a brush roller. With very few exceptions, most vacuums will use either a flat belt, round belt, or a geared style belt.
The type of belt that your vacuum uses is very important, not only for durability, but performance as well. The condition and type of belt your vacuum uses will have a lot of impact on the systems ability to clean carpet. The proper use of agitation is almost 70% of the cleaning ability of a vacuum cleaner.
Suction is also very important. The suction is what pulls the dirt that is removed from the carpet into the collection area of the vacuum. The suction, or airflow, is the key when cleaning hard surfaces or when using attachments. Without suction, a vacuum cleaner could only bring more dirt to the surface of carpet. Even though both agitation and suction are important with vacuuming, the agitation is what actually cleans them.
Almost all manufacturers use brush rollers that are made of wood, metal, or even plastic that is driven by a suction or brush motor through the use of three different kinds of belts - round, geared, or flat.
The round belts are the earliest type as they were easy to produce and easy to engineer. The round style, unfortunately, is normally run in the same space as vacuumed dirt. What this means, is that almost all of the dirt, staples, and hair you vacuum up will pass around the belt; cutting, nicking, or even scratching it along the way.
Vacuum cleaner belts have to stretch quite a long way, placing even more stress on the roller and the motor bearings. The round belt is still common, and used even today.
The flat style of belts are most often run in a circular fashion as well, unlike the twisted route the round belt takes to deliver the performance in the proper direction.
The style allow manufacturers to run the belt off of one side of the brush roller, instead of the center where all of the dirt is. This is truly a great innovation, as you can eliminate premature failure due to the soil and dirt in the belt path.
The latest belt design is considered to be the best in the industry. Even though there are many variations out there, the geared belt is the most efficient means to drive a brush. The geared belt is also known as a positive brush system because the energy of the brush motor is transmitted directly to the brush.
Both the brush and the motor are locked by fixed teeth to each other through a cogged belt without tension. The resulting direct connection results in higher cleaning efficiency because the brush can be driven at a faster speed regardless of the age of the belt.
The flat style can stretch as they become warm, which will cause them to lose tension. When you use your vacuum, the belt is always going to stretch. Believe it or not, it will lose it's tension the moment you put it up to rest in the closet.
There is however, one real drawback to geared belts - the cost of the vacuum. Geared belts are normally used on two motor vacuums. Not only does this require a separate suction and brush motor, but it also requires electronic sensory systems to tell you when something is wrong with the brush.

Where can i find the cost of power transmission elements?
I am in a process of making a machine for my project and i need estimates for costing of the power transmission elements used like V-belt drives, Bearings, roller chain drives, bevel gears etc...
Anyone know where to find it on the internet?
By the way cost in INR would be useful.
Do a search on the web for companies that make the products that you're looking for. Call them (their sales dept's numbers are generally on their websites) and ask for budgetary pricing for whatever product you're looking for.
Since this is for a school project, they likely won't want to spend a lot of time with you unless there is a chance that the machine will actually be built. If it may actually be built, let them know that. It increases their willingness to help you.
Good luck
**EDIT**
I forgot to mention, it's pretty rare for companies to put prices on their websites for stuff like this (assuming they are large commercial items), so the phone is your best bet.
